Definitions of tidewater word
- noun tidewater water affected by the flow and ebb of the tide. 1
- noun tidewater the water covering tideland at flood tide. 1
- noun tidewater seacoast. 1
- noun tidewater water affected by ocean tides 1
- noun tidewater low-lying coastal area 1

Origin of tidewater
First appearance:
before 1765 One of the 46% newest English words
First recorded in 1765-75; tide1 + water
